Question: In anticipation of the coming year, Tecumseh Autos, a national auto manufacturer, is anticipating sales of its vehicles. Tecumseh manufactures compact cars, sedans, minivans, trucks, SUVs, and sports cars. In all categories of vehicles, Tecumseh sets prices so that the profit per vehicle is, on average, about the same. Since the best indicator for sales in each category are the sales last year, Tecumseh’s marketing analysts’ prediction of the three most profitable categories of vehicles in the coming year will be compact cars, minivans, and SUVs respectively.

Tecumseh’s marketing analysts’ prediction relies on which one of the following assumptions?

(A) Across all manufacturers, the most popular cars on the road in America are compact cars, minivans, and SUVs.
(B) The models of Tecumseh’s compact cars to be sold in the upcoming year are identical to or similar to those of last year.
(C) Last year, no other category of Tecumseh’s vehicles generated more profits than SUVs and less than minivans.
(D) The prediction will be refined after an analysis of the sales in the first quarter of this year.
(E) The number of models of compacts cars that Tecumseh produces is greater than the number of models of either minivans or SUVs.

Answer: C
Solution and Explanation:

In this GMAT critical reasoning question, we are looking for something that is implied in the argument. This is an assumption is an implied hypothesis. So, we will be looking at the hypothesis and the conclusion which can be drawn.

As per the passage-

Hypothesis: In anticipation of the coming year, Tecumseh Autos, a national auto manufacturer, is anticipating sales of its vehicles.
Hypothesis: Tecumseh manufactures compact cars, sedans, minivans, trucks, SUVs, and sports cars.
Hypothesis: In all categories of vehicles, Tecumseh sets prices so that the profit per vehicle is, on average, about the same.
Hypothesis: Since the best indicator for sales in each category are the sales last year,
Conclusion: Tecumseh’s marketing analysts’ prediction of the three most profitable categories of vehicles in the coming year will be compact cars, minivans, and SUVs respectively.

From the above hypothesis and conclusion, we can conclude that 3 categories would be profitable for coming year. It can be also stated that compact cars, minivans, and SUVs would be same as previous year. 

We can draw assumptions like: 

1) Buyers of these 3 models are comparatively more than for other types
2) Last year sales of these 3 models were more than in other types
3) As profit on average is the same per vehicle, there would be more buyers to make these types most profitable

Now let us check the given assumptions:

(A) Across all manufacturers, the most popular cars on the road in America are compact cars, minivans, and SUVs.
All manufacturers are out of scope. Hence incorrect. 
(B) The models of Tecumseh’s compact cars to be sold in the upcoming year are identical to or similar to those of last year.
In the option it is not mentioned in the given assumption about the model changes would increase or not. Hence incorrect. 
(C) Last year, no other category of Tecumseh’s vehicles generated more profits than SUVs and less than minivans.
This option states that other types of Tecumseh’s vehicles bings more profit in comparison to SUVs. Hence this is the correct answer.
(D) The prediction will be refined after an analysis of the sales in the first quarter of this year.
Option D is Irrelevant.
(E) The number of models of compacts cars that Tecumseh produces is greater than the number of models of either minivans or SUVs.
Option E is not concerned with sales. It is also not concerned about the production data. Hence incorrect.
